If you want deep understanding of the language immerse yourself in it. Not only buy books specifically geared towards grammar, usage, etc, also grab newspapers, novels, anything to give you an idea of slang in the culture, writing styles. Find someone to practice with. To speak fluently, you have to practice nonstop. You will casually increase your lists of words phrases because the more you repeat conversations in certain contexts the more you remember and don’t have to recall translations in your head.
